Adapting to a Warmer World
The context in which Nagatitan lived is, in my opinion, the most thought-provoking aspect of this find. This colossal sauropod roamed during a period of rising atmospheric carbon dioxide and high global temperatures. It seems counterintuitive, doesn't it? Large animals, especially herbivores like sauropods, are essentially giant heat sinks. How did they manage to thrive when the planet was essentially a giant oven? This is where the real scientific intrigue lies for me. It challenges our assumptions about the limits of life and the remarkable adaptability of ancient ecosystems.
The Sauropod Enigma
Professor Paul Upchurch's observation that sauropods seemed to cope with higher temperatures is something I find particularly puzzling and exciting. We tend to think of large bodies as a disadvantage in hot climates, making it difficult to dissipate heat. Yet, here we have evidence of these massive creatures flourishing. What this suggests to me is that our modern understanding of thermoregulation might not fully capture the nuances of dinosaur physiology or the specific environmental conditions of the time. Perhaps they had evolved unique cooling mechanisms, or maybe the available plant life, which was crucial for their diet, was somehow more resilient or abundant in those warmer climes.
